在当今数字化时代,服务器作为信息处理和存储的核心设备,承担着重要的任务。有时服务器会出现卡顿的情况,导致用户体验下降甚至服务中断。了解服务器卡顿的原因以及解决方法对于服务器运维人员和网络管理员至关重要。
2. 服务器卡顿的原因和解决方法
2.1 硬件问题
服务器硬件问题是导致卡顿的一大原因。例如,服务器的处理器性能不足、内存容量不足或者硬盘读写速度慢等。解决硬件问题的方法包括升级硬件设备、增加内存容量或者更换更高性能的处理器。
2.2 网络问题
网络问题也是服务器卡顿的常见原因之一。例如,网络带宽不足、网络延迟高或者网络丢包率过高等。解决网络问题的方法包括增加网络带宽、优化网络路由、调整网络设备配置以及使用负载均衡等技术手段。
2.3 软件问题
服务器上的软件问题也可能导致卡顿。例如,操作系统或者应用程序存在bug、配置错误或者资源占用过高等。解决软件问题的方法包括及时更新操作系统和应用程序的补丁、优化配置文件以及合理分配资源等。
2.4 安全问题
服务器安全问题也可能导致卡顿。例如,服务器遭受到恶意攻击、病毒感染或者被黑客入侵等。解决安全问题的方法包括加强服务器的防火墙设置、定期进行安全扫描和漏洞修补、及时备份数据以及使用加密技术等。
2.5 负载过高
服务器负载过高也会导致卡顿。例如,服务器同时处理大量的请求或者运行多个高消耗资源的应用程序。解决负载过高问题的方法包括优化应用程序的代码、增加服务器的处理能力、使用负载均衡技术以及合理分配资源等。
2.6 温度过高
服务器过热也是导致卡顿的原因之一。高温会导致硬件故障或者降低硬件性能。解决温度过高问题的方法包括增加散热设备、改善服务器的通风条件以及定期清理服务器内部的灰尘等。
2.7 日志过多
服务器日志过多也可能导致卡顿。大量的日志文件会占用服务器的存储空间和处理能力。解决日志过多问题的方法包括定期清理无用的日志文件、优化日志记录方式以及使用日志压缩技术等。
2.8 缓存问题
缓存问题也可能导致服务器卡顿。例如,缓存过期失效或者缓存容量不足。解决缓存问题的方法包括设置合理的缓存过期时间、增加缓存容量以及使用分布式缓存技术等。
服务器卡顿的原因多种多样,涉及硬件、网络、软件、安全等方面。解决服务器卡顿问题需要综合考虑各个方面的因素,并采取相应的措施。只有保持服务器的稳定运行,才能提供高效可靠的服务。